Composite Number

55101

55101 is a odd composite number that follows 55100 and precedes 55102. It is composed of 4 distinct factors: 1, 3, 18367, 55101. Its prime factorization can be written as 3 × 18367. 55101 is classified as a deficient number based on the sum of its proper divisors. In computer science, 55101 is represented as 1101011100111101 in binary and D73D in hexadecimal.
